PYOVERDINES ARE A GROUP OF STRUCTURALLY RELATED SIDEROPHORES
PRODUCED BY FLUORESCENT PSEUDOMONAS SPECIES. PYOVERDINE IS
NECESSARY FOR INFECTION IN SEVERAL DIFFERENT DISEASE MODELS.
THE OCCURRENCE OF PYOVERDINE-DEFECTIVE STRAINS IN CHRONIC
INFECTIONS OF PATIENTS WITH CYSTIC FIBROSIS AND THE EXTREMELY
HIGH SEQUENCE DIVERSITY OF GENES INVOLVED IN PYOVERDINE SYNTHESIS
AND UPTAKE INDICATE THAT PYOVERDINE PRODUCTION IS SUBJECT TO
HIGH EVOLUTIONARY PRESSURE. PYOVERDINE-DEPENDENT IRON TRANSPORT
IS ALSO CRUCIAL FOR BIOFILM DEVELOPMENT, FURTHER EXPANDING THE
IMPORTANCE OF THESE SIDEROPHORES IN PSEUDOMONAS BIOLOGY.

IN IRON-DEFICIENT CONDITIONS, PSEUDOMONAS AERUGINOSA
SECRETES A MAJOR FLUORESCENT SIDEROPHORE NAMED PYOVERDIN (PVD),
WHICH AFTER CHELATING IRON(III) IS TRANSPORTED BACK INTO THE
CELL VIA ITS OUTER MEMBRANE RECEPTOR FPVA. FPVA IS A
TONB-DEPENDENT TRANSPORT PROTEIN AND HAS THE ABILITY TO BIND
PVD IN ITS APO- OR IRON-LOADED FORM.
